Macro Industry Evolution

The global micro-mobility sector has shifted dramatically towards high-stability multi-wheeled formats. As urban environments enforce strict emission regulations, the need for light electric vehicles (LEVs) that balance spatial flexibility with substantial payloads has skyrocketed. 3-wheel electric motor scooters and light quadricycles fill a critical void, offering more stability than standard 2-wheel scooters and lower operating costs than traditional commercial delivery vans.

According to current B2B market analytics, key regions like South Korea, Thailand, Brazil, and Mexico are registering double-digit CAGR growth in 3-wheel LEV adoption, driven by the surging demand of urban e-commerce deliveries, leisure rentals, and senior-focused assistive transit. Importers require models that easily integrate into existing logistics platforms or municipal ride programs.

Addressing Global Procurement Obstacles

B2B procurement agents face persistent friction points regarding quality control, homologation, and supply chain timelines. When sourcing wholesale electric scooters, buyers demand answers on structural integrity, battery chemistry safety, and compliance with local transport policies.

  • Chassis Degradation: Cheap tubular frames rust rapidly under coastal conditions. Aiweda solves this with high-carbon steel and robotic dual-seam welding.
  • Customs Homologation: Vehicles must meet regional safety codes. We secure CE & EEC certifications to streamline customs entry.
  • Battery Lifecycle: Unstable BMS controllers degrade lithium cells within months. We deploy premium 48V/60V lithium setups with integrated cell balancing.

Key System Integrations

  • Regenerative Braking: Automatically charges batteries during downhill descents while avoiding free-rolling.
  • Brushless DC Motors: High-efficiency planetary gears offer quiet operation and require zero carbon brush maintenance.
  • AI Autopilot Assist: Keeps track straight under crosswinds and features voice-activated route/safety prompts.

B2B Procurement & Export FAQ

Common questions regarding minimum orders, customization, compliance, and international shipping.

1. What are your Minimum Order Quantity (MOQ) requirements?

As a wholesale exporter, our standard MOQ starts at a 20GP container (approximately 20 to 45 units, depending on the model's dimensions). Sample units are available for certified B2B distributors to evaluate build quality prior to volume orders.

2. Do your electric scooters and quadricycles have CE & EEC certifications?

Yes. Our primary export models, including the S-3, M9, and A1 series, are CE certified. We provide complete technical documentation and safety certificates to assist our partners with customs clearance and local road registration.

3. Can you customize the AI features, voice systems, and branding (OEM/ODM)?

Yes. We offer comprehensive OEM/ODM options. We can customize localized voice packs, pre-program speed limits to meet municipal codes, add custom decals, and adjust structural specifications like cargo dimensions or shock absorption rating.

4. What battery configurations do you offer, and what is the typical range?

We offer both lead-acid and lithium-ion (LiFePO4/NMC) batteries. Configurations range from 48V/12Ah for lightweight folding scooters to 60V/45Ah for commercial cargo units. Average operating ranges run from 45km to 95km per charge, depending on payload and terrain.

5. How do you handle shipping logistics and after-sales support?

We export to international markets including South Korea, Thailand, Brazil, and Mexico. We coordinate shipping with global freight partners and provide a complete package of spare parts (motors, controllers, throttle assemblies) along with remote video troubleshooting support from our engineering team.
